VERB

senden/ˈzɛndn̩/to send; to transmit; to broadcast

senden is a German verb that means to send, to transmit, or to broadcast. It is pronounced /ˈzɛndn̩/. In conjugation, the simple past is "sendete" and the past participle is "gesendet".

Definitions

1.to send (something, e.g. a letter, parcel, or message)(communication, mail)

a.to dispatch or send something to someone

Bitte senden Sie mir die Unterlagen per E-Mail.Please send me the documents by email.

2.to transmit or broadcast something (e.g. on TV or radio)(media, broadcasting)

a.to broadcast a program

Die Sendung wird um 20 Uhr gesendet.The program will be broadcast at 8 PM.

Conjugation

Infinitivesenden
Present (ich)sende
Present (du)sendest
Present (er/sie/es)sendet
Preterite (ich)sendete
Participle IIgesendet
Konjunktiv II (ich)sendete
Imperative (singular)sende
Imperative (plural)sendet
Auxiliaryhaben
